It's a 10 mins walk uphill from train station so maybe better to try to contact them for a complimentary pick up.
The place is super grand and 2 onsens. A Instagram worthy one that the males and females get to use it at different timings. The shower stuff in the onsen are mediocre though. No fancy facial stuff for women unlike some other onsens at this price range.
We had breakfast and dinner for the 2 nights. And well worth it. But you have to follow a fixed timing and we felt a bit rushed but otherwise it was really great and service perfect.
We had one the biggest rooms I believe Room 716. Had a sitting area and also a sleeping area. Easily fits 8 persons. We were only 2. In the day they kept the futons and brought it out at night. Towels changed every night.
There is a van that goes straight to Mount Yokoteyama ski resort. The receptionist didn't seem to know about it but you could try to Google. It was a complimentary ride to and fro if you bought the lift tickets. Took only like 30 mins to get there. You can get rentals at hotels there.

Easy to go to Giant Ski Area because there is a slope to ski area directly. But I don't recommend for beginner to go ski area from this slope. And you can't go back to the hotel from this way, you have to go back by gondola to Yamanoeki and walk 300m. Too far if you walk with skies or snowboard.
Yukata is not free of charge, you have to pay 300 yens for rent. There is a shower room in your room but you can't use it because there is ONLY cold water(hot water doesn't work).
Some breakfast menu is not enough for customers. But dinner is ok.
